• 欢迎使用千万蜘蛛池,网站外链优化,蜘蛛池引蜘蛛快速提高网站收录,收藏快捷键 CTRL + D

“Oracle中ID的秘密:如何快速生成、自定义和管理ID”


什么是主键?

在Oracle数据库中,每一个表都有一个唯一的标识符,称为主键(Primary Key),主键用于唯一地标识表中的每一行数据。主键确保表中数据的完整性和唯一性,提供快速的数据访问和查询。

如何创建主键?

在创建表时,可以使用PRIMARY KEY关键字来定义主键。主键可以由一个或多个列组成,这些列的值必须唯一且不为空。如果主键只包含一个列,那么该列的值必须唯一且不为空;如果主键包含多个列,那么所有列的组合值必须唯一且不为空。

创建主键

主键的类型有哪些?

Oracle支持多种类型的主键,包括:单列主键、多列主键、复合主键和自动递增主键。

  • 单列主键:由单个列组成的主键,可以是任何数据类型。
  • 多列主键:由多个列组成的主键,这些列的组合值必须唯一且不为空。
  • 复合主键:由多个列组成的主键,这些列的组合值必须唯一且不为空,但其中的某一列或几列可以为空。
  • 自动递增主键:由一个整数列组成的主键,该列的值会自动递增。
主键类型

如何修改主键?

如果需要修改主键的定义,可以使用ALTER TABLE语句来实现。修改主键时,需要先删除原有的主键约束,然后再添加新的主键约束。

修改主键

如何删除主键?

如果需要删除主键,可以使用DROP PRIMARY KEY语句来实现。删除主键后,表中的数据仍然保持完整,但不再有唯一的标识符。

删除主键

主键的作用和限制

主键的作用是确保表中的数据完整性和唯一性,提供快速的数据访问和查询。主键的限制包括:不能为空、不能重复、不能包含NULL值等。

结尾

通过本文,我们了解了主键在Oracle数据库中的重要性和作用,以及如何创建、修改和删除主键。如果您有任何疑问或意见,请在下方留言

本文链接:https://www.24zzc.com/news/171380462169977.html

相关文章推荐

    无相关信息

蜘蛛工具

  • WEB标准颜色卡
  • 域名筛选工具
  • 中文转拼音工具